Sinopse

Ocean Waves explores the science behind ocean waves, tides, and currents, revealing their interconnectedness and impact on our planet. It emphasizes the importance of understanding ocean dynamics for coastal management, navigation safety, and predicting coastal hazards. For instance, the book examines how wind energy transfers to the water's surface to generate waves, and how the gravitational forces of the moon and sun influence tides.

 
This book traces the evolution of our understanding of wave mechanics, from early observations to modern mathematical models. It investigates phenomena like wave interference, rogue waves, and tsunami generation. Ocean Waves also connects to other fields such as meteorology and geology, enriching our perspective and underscoring the importance of a holistic approach to ocean studies.

 
The book progresses logically, beginning with basic wave formation principles, then moves on to the science of tides, the origins of extreme waves, and, finally, the practical implications of wave science. Supported by oceanographic survey data and historical records, it offers an integrated perspective of the latest research alongside established theories, making it a valuable resource for students, researchers, and anyone interested in Earth science and the dynamic nature of our oceans.

    Through atmospheric descriptions and vivid portraits, When Echoes Speak offers glimpses into exotic worlds, taking the reader from a drab displaced persons camp, to the throbbing rhythms of Rio’s frenzied Carnival, to heartrending encounters in Ethiopia. In looking back, Dag Scheer discovers intricate and rich patterns in her life and weaves together the connecting threads.A blend of memoir and cultural exploration, When Echoes Speak distills the defining moments of an unusual life. In August of 1944, when Dag was five, she and her family fled Latvia to escape Soviet occupation. After five harsh years in a displaced persons camp in Germany, the family settled in Cleveland, Ohio. Growing up, Dag was caught in a painful pull between her Latvian roots and her new life in America.Determined to find her own path, she left home to teach in Libya where she met Stuart Scheer, a young charismatic doctor. They explored Libya’s scorching desert terrain together, and their intense relationship deepened. After they married, Stuart’s work took them to eight different countries across the globe. In recounting the frustrations and delights of each new location and its unique culture, Dag probes her inner transformations. Ultimately, the shifting perspective of being perpetually out of place helped her find a sense of self.

    An essential book for any textile artist looking to expand their repertoire into two- and three-dimensional work. Leading textile artist, teacher and examiner Jean Draper takes you through the entire process from designing through construction to embellishment with mixed media.
    This beautiful and very practical book includes diagrams, detailed drawings and stitch information to guide the reader through the techniques, which include hand and machine embroidery. It covers: Design, including recording information for translation into stitch (with lots of drawing tips); Choice of Threads, including some unusual threads and customizing them; Constructing with Thread, everything from knotted forms, with decorative threads, grids and stacks, and coiled structures; Stitches in Thin Air, constructing with stitch alone using moulds and soluble fabric; Using Mixed Media in Stitched Structures, such as paper, sticks, wire and plastics; Adding Structure to an Existing Fabric; Three-Dimensional Fabric Structures.
    Working in two and three-dimensions is a growing genre of textile art and this incorporates a fresh approach and great design advice.
